The Intelligent Transport System (ITS) refers to a system that utilizes visual, analytical, control and communication technologies to manage different modes of on-road transportation efficiently. It is not only embedded within a vehicle but also in the infrastructure facilities to enhance on-road safety and achieve traffic efficiency by minimizing traffic problems. It uses various equipment such as ramp meters, electronic toll collectors, traffic light cameras, traffic-signal coordinators, transit signal systems and traveler-information systems.

The increasing number of smart cities, along with unprecedented population growth leading to widespread traffic congestion, are the key factors driving the market growth. The ITS significantly aids in the effective management of on-road traffic through Global Positioning System (GPS), Dedicated Short Range Communication (DSRC) and Carrier Access for Land Mobiles (CALM).

Additionally, increasing occurrence of deaths due to road accidents have driven the demand for ITS across the globe. Advanced features such as Vehicle-to-Vehicle (V2V) and Vehicle-to-Infrastructure (V2I) communication is creating a positive outlook for the market.

These features provide real-time information to travelers about road conditions and construction zones, along with seat availability and timings of public modes of transport, thus enhancing the overall on-road safety and reducing the chances of fatalities while reducing the travel time.

Moreover, increasing focus on research and development (R&D) in both the public and private sectors to incorporate more enhanced features is also contributing to the market growth.
